Safe Haskell | None |
---|---|
Language | Haskell2010 |
Synopsis
- module Data.Curve.Weierstrass
- type PP = WPPoint BN512 Fq Fr
- type PJ = WJPoint BN512 Fq Fr
- type PA = WAPoint BN512 Fq Fr
- type R = 13407807929942597099574024998205830437246153344875111580494527427714590099881680053891920200409570720654742146445677939306408461754626647833262056300743149
- type Fr = Prime R
- type Q = 13407807929942597099574024998205830437246153344875111580494527427714590099881795845981157516604994291639750834285779043186149750164319950153126044364566323
- type Fq = Prime Q
- data BN512
- _a :: Fq
- _b :: Fq
- _h :: Natural
- _q :: Natural
- _r :: Natural
- _x :: Fq
- _y :: Fq
- gA :: PA
- gJ :: PJ
- gP :: PP
Documentation
module Data.Curve.Weierstrass
BN512 curve
type R = 13407807929942597099574024998205830437246153344875111580494527427714590099881680053891920200409570720654742146445677939306408461754626647833262056300743149 Source #
type Q = 13407807929942597099574024998205830437246153344875111580494527427714590099881795845981157516604994291639750834285779043186149750164319950153126044364566323 Source #